Similarly, we observe that MuBr85 mRNA sequences, expressed in the brain and particularly in the pyramidal but not granule neurons of the hippocampus, are also synthesized in the anterior pituitary. , (1983) have demonstrated that the mRNA encoding the hormone precursor POMC is expressed in neurons of the rat hypothalamus, although clearly not to the extensive regions of the brain found for the expression of mRNA sequence MuBr85. As described above the cDNA sequence pMuBr85 hybridizes to multiple RNA species but appears to be encoded by a single genetic loci.
